Biography
Paul DiGiammarino has 30+ years of experience in lead operating, governance, and market development roles in emerging ventures. He is a serial entrepreneur who brings a distinguished record of success to every organization he works with.
While serving as EVP, North America, for Sapient, Inc. and CEO of Steelpoint and Anaqua, Paul led organizations to realize an average of more than 10X return on investments to clients and investors through outstanding client service and rapid sales growth. Paul was also a member of the executive team of American Management Systems (now owned by CGI), that grew from $50 million to $1 billion during his tenure. He started his career with Coopers and Lybrand, now owned by PWC.
Paul holds a CPA and a BBA with concentration in Accounting and Computer Science from the University of Massachusetts at Amherst.
